Water Crisis in Arizona's Urban Areas

Arizona has been facing escalating water shortages, particularly in urban centers where population growth and climate challenges intersect. The Arizona Department of Water Resources reports that approximately 1.4 million residents, predominantly low-income households, are at risk of experiencing severe water deprivation during extreme heat events or other emergencies. This precarious situation highlights the urgent need for systems that can swiftly respond to water crises, ensuring access to safe drinking water remains consistent.

Outcomes Targeted by the Grant Program

The Emergency Community Water Assistance Grants focus on developing rapid-response systems tailored for urban settings, particularly in neighborhoods that frequently encounter water shortages. Eligible applicants include city governments, non-profits, and community organizations that can mobilize resources effectively to serve vulnerable populations. To qualify for the program, proposals must demonstrate a clear strategy for real-time monitoring and rapid deployment protocols for water distribution during emergencies, as well as ongoing systems maintenance plans.

Importance of Targeted Outcomes in Arizona

The outcomes targeted by this initiative are crucial for maintaining public health and ensuring community resilience amid ongoing water challenges. By funding projects that enhance crisis-response capabilities, Arizona aims to reduce health risks associated with water scarcity, particularly for lower-income households more susceptible to the impacts of water shortages. This focus is particularly important in areas where resources are often stretched thin, and established systems are inadequate for addressing immediate needs.

Implementation Strategies and Community Involvement

Successful implementations will depend heavily on collaboration among local stakeholders, including emergency management agencies, health officials, and community organizations. The grant program encourages applicants to present plans that include community engagement mechanisms and local governance structures to foster accountability and transparency.
